Sensors for Freshness 

With wellness supplements, you need to stay on the ball regarding if they’re fresh enough to use or not. if they aren’t, they may not offer benefits. 

At worst, it might also cause you to have issues with the product and may cause health issues as a result.

Sensors are now being added to provide freshness indicators and will tell you exactly when the expiration dates are. Some of them offer real-time information on just how fresh the items are and offer real instructions on what to do if the item is not fresh anymore.

This is great, because it means you’re getting the best product possible, and allows you to keep track, so you’re not eating old and stale supplements. 

QR Codes 

Ahh QR codes. Some people love them, some people hate them. However, people like this because it will tell them so much. 

QR codes are little bar codes you can scan, that will take you to pretty much anything. wellness brands use these for usage instructions, and also important expiration dates to be mindful of. 

A lot of brands are using this, rather than littering the box with a bunch of information on directions. It looks cleaner, promotes a more minimalistic approach, and for customers that have trouble reading small lettering, this is better for them. 

NFC Tracking 

NFC Tracking is a wireless type of RFID that offers contactless communication. It means that you can track the location as well to provide security and data. 

Some fitness and medical brands use this with your information, connecting the product to your own personal health. In turn, it can offer data that will help you track not only your product, but also other health statistics as well.

Reusable Packaging, and how it Opens the door to sustainable Futures 

Sometimes, recycling isn’t going to cut it. biodegradable packaging is still pretty new, and you might not be ready to shoulder the costs for sourcing.

Enter reusable packaging. It’s what it says it is. it’s packaging that allows you to use and reuse it again. Think of those mailers that have a little sticky end for returns, or a box that can be repurposed for shipping something else out or holding it. there’s a ton of different types of ways to reuse packaging, and here we’ll go over how it’s done. 

Durable Construction and Design 

With reusable packaging, there’s a lot of emphasis on the durability of materials, and their design. You’re not just making a package that’s going to be used once, but multiple times. boxes that are reusable tend to be thicker and offer a lot of fun ways to really improve the construction process. 

You want to make sure that when you design this, use corrugated materials, and consider using a harder plastic or bottle to use again and again. 

Designs for Usages 

Now, not every reusable package is going to be just a box that you can use in the future for another item. They can be designed for many different uses. 

For instance, a box that turns into a hanger, or even a box that has perforated edges, in order to cut out a game, are good examples of this.   Having a box that doubles as a fort for kids is a great way to get the little ones involved, enhancing the experience and making this even more fun for everyone. 

The benefits and Challenges of this 

When you’re using reusable packaging, you’re grossly reducing waste. There’s less being tossed away. Little by little, it saves the planet, making it a valuable item for a lot of people looking to really enhance their product and packaging. 

It also is good for the environment. You’re tossing out less plastic and waste, and thereby, enhancing the overall experience of such. You’d be surprised at the difference that this makes, and the results that come from all of this too.

But with this, comes some challenges. Reusable packaging does need to be more durable. This can be a problem, especially in the costs front, because corrugated and double-walled sorts of boxes do cost a lot more to produce, and you’re taking a gamble on if the person’s going to actually use it. 

The second thing is the usability of it.   some items might not be easy to use again and again, especially if you’re someone who doesn’t really see a use for it. kids may like box forts, but how long are they going to use this?   it can in turn create a problem in the form of the way you handle your boxes.   That’s why it’s important that, if you plan to design these, you’re able to create something that has some semblance of reusability that will help the person that buys it use it.

Challenges of holiday Packaging 

Holiday packaging however has some big challenges that come along with this, which are worth mentioning.

The first thing is that they can be costly. With limited runs like this, customers might not want this type of packaging all year round. You have to make special orders, and that can be quite the costs for some businesses. Bear this in mind, because you can’t use holiday wrapping all year round, and if you’re offering collectable packaging, you’re going to have a lot of excess stock if it doesn’t sell.

The second problem is the production timeline. This can definitely be a bit of a troublesome thing to get set up. you may think you ordered this on time, but then you’re scrambling weeks before the day of release, and then you’re starting to look for ways to make up for this issue. 

It can be quite annoying to chase up producers, so the best way to prevent this from being a major problem is to try and focus on the production times and finding a supplier that caters to your lead times. do this, and you won’t have issues.
